Tryed something new...

But look how cute. Believe it or not...these are simple twists. I french
braided the back then I grabbed a section of hair on left side of
head...twisted it to the right and anchored it to the left with a
decorative clip. On the right...I twisted toward the left and anchored
it on the right. In the center I split the section in two...one got
twist left...one got twisted right...anchored the ends in the center and
pulled the hair over the clip. Done. This is a 5 min style. Wrap lightly
with a scarf...go to bed.
